August is National Wellness Month, and every ad you'll see this month sells the same story. A bath. A journal. A weekend alone to "recharge." We're doing this one differently.

Come move with us instead.

We're gathering at Kenneth Hahn for a morning that starts with a hike, moves into yoga wave practice, and ends with food and stillness in a circle of people who showed up for the same reason you did. No mats to master. No pace to keep up with. Just breath, trail, and company.

This one's rooted in the first stage of our Root to Rise framework — grounding in body, breath, and nature — because before anything else, wellness starts with coming back to yourself. And we've found that's easier to do next to someone else doing it too.


What to expect:
Opening circle, mindful hike, yoga wave practice, group photo, and a BYO picnic to close things out. Bring water, layers, and whatever you need for the ground.

Hike to Yoga started with a simple idea: that when we heal in nature, we heal ourselves and each other. Today, it’s clear that environmental justice is inseparable from community care. Too many of our neighborhoods lack safe, healthy green spaces—just like ecosystems suffer when biodiversity is lost, people suffer when human diversity isn’t embraced. Hike to Yoga is about aligning people and the planet, building belonging through mindful hikes, yoga, and collective restoration. Our vision is to expand nationally, creating Peace Warrior hubs in every city with a park—because we believe healing is contagious, and together we can restore our land, our communities, and our humanity.
